Meowmbai exists because people care about community cats in the cities we cover. These guidelines protect that community and the mission behind it. They apply to everything you upload, caption, or contribute, in every city on the Platform.

What we're here to do

Document cats. Share sightings. Build a collective record of street cat populations across the Indian cities the Platform covers. That's it. The platform is for the cats, not for controversy, harassment, or self-promotion.

Rules

Only upload cats

Every photo should contain a real cat you genuinely spotted in a city the Platform covers. No stock photos. No AI-generated images. No fake sightings. No other animals.

Be accurate about location

Pin the cat where you actually saw it. Don't fabricate locations. Approximate is fine - exact is not required - but deliberate misinformation degrades the map for everyone.

No humans in focus

Photos should focus on the cat. If a person is incidentally visible in the background that may be acceptable, but photos where a human's face is clearly identifiable will be removed. Photos of children will always be removed regardless of context.

Blur or avoid licence plates

If a vehicle's licence plate is clearly readable in your photo, we may ask you to resubmit with it obscured.

No animal harm content

Do not upload photos that depict animal abuse, injury, or distress caused by humans. Content that glorifies or celebrates harm to animals will result in immediate account suspension and referral to relevant authorities.

No harassment

Do not use cat captions, lore, or comments to mock, target, or harass other contributors. Do not use the platform to stalk or track individuals.

Respect privacy

Do not include identifiable addresses, unit numbers, or other private location details in captions. Do not use the platform to expose the home addresses or routines of other people.

No spam

Don't submit duplicate sightings of the same cat in the same location on the same day. Don't use the platform to advertise products or services.

Report and tip honestly

Only report a cat as missing if you genuinely believe it is - not as a joke, a test, or to see what happens. When you leave a tip on someone's missing cat report, only say you've seen or found the cat if you actually believe you have; a false "found" tip wastes a worried owner's time.

Use contact details respectfully

A missing cat report's contact details can be revealed by any visitor trying to help. Only use them to help find that specific cat - not to add someone to a mailing list, sell them something, or contact them for anything unrelated. Reward, cash, or payment offers are not allowed in a report or tip.

Enforcement

Violations are handled on a graduated basis:

LevelActionApplies when
WarningContent removed, user notifiedMinor first offence (e.g. inaccurate location)
RestrictionUploads paused for 7 daysRepeated minor violations or single moderate violation
SuspensionAccount suspended for 30 daysSerious violation or repeated restricted behaviour
Permanent BanAccount terminatedSevere violation (animal abuse, harassment, doxxing) or repeated suspension

You may appeal any enforcement decision by emailing meowmbai.fun@gmail.com within 14 days, including the post URL and why you think the decision was wrong.

Reporting content

See something that violates these guidelines? Use the Report Content button on any post and pick the category that fits - wrong location, not a cat, privacy concern, copyright, animal harm, spam, harassment, misleading info, or anything else. You'll get a reference number, and we'll review it - urgent safety and privacy reports get looked at first. For anything urgent, you can also email meowmbai.fun@gmail.com directly. Your identity as a reporter is never shared with the person you're reporting, and reporting in bad faith to target someone is itself a violation of these Guidelines.

Getting content removed

Content comes down when it breaks these Guidelines, infringes a copyright (see our Copyright Policy), reveals a private individual, child, or sensitive location, or is required to be removed under a valid court order. You can delete any of your own posts yourself at any time from your profile - it disappears immediately and storage is purged shortly after.
